Christian Sinding is one of those unfortunate composers who owe their world fame to a single piece. Rustle of Spring immortalised his name and, despite it's brevity, overshadowed the rich oeuvre of the Norwegian, who was once considered the legitimate successor to Edvard Grieg. And this despite the fact that he did not rely on his country's folk music, but on the great genres of Central Europe, which he contributed to with four symphonies, three violin concertos and a great deal of chamber music. Among them are three elegant, expressive, artful, vividly orchestrated, and exceptionally beautiful piano trios, which with this release expand our already unrivalled Sinding catalogue. The Six Pieces for cello and piano are also of the highest quality. They form a precious, ultra-Romantic 'encore' that is also featured as a first recording here.
